mFluor™ UV375 Anti-human CD54 Antibody
R6-5-D6
R6-5-D6 is an anti-human monoclonal antibody that targets the CD54 antigen. CD54 (also known as ICAM-1, ICAM1 or Ly-47) is a 85 - 110 kD member of the Ig superfamily that is expressed on the surface of cells such as B cells, endothelial cells and macrophages. CD54 is associated with a variety of biologically interesting macromolecules/ligands, for example, LFA-1, Mac-1 and Rhinovirus. CD54 is a fairly uncommon antibody target, with a little more than 4400 publications in the last decade. Even still, CD54 is essential for costimulatory molecules, neuroscience and immunology research, often serving as a phenotypic marker for differentiating cell types in flow cytometric applications. This antibody was purified through affinity chromatography and conjugated to mFluor™ UV375 (ex/em = 351/387 nm). It is compatible with the 355 nm laser and 379/28 nm bandpass filter (for example, as in the BD FACSymphony™ A5).
